Abstract
The utility model is related to jig fields, especially self-adaptation type jig.The jig includes fixed plate, positioning framework, part, briquetting, fixed pin one and boss, the both sides up and down of the same end face of fixed plate are respectively equipped with boss, fixed plate is equipped with fixed pin one, fixed pin one is placed in the mounting hole of part, part both sides are respectively equipped with positioning framework, and positioning framework is fixedly connected in fixed plate, and briquetting is slidably connected with positioning framework, briquetting one end fits with boss, and the briquetting other end is fixedly connected with part.The utility model is by the briquetting that can move horizontally, to be positioned to the part of different in width, to improve adaptability of the jig for different in width part.

A kind of self-adaptation type jig, including fixed plate 1, positioning framework 2, part 3, briquetting 4, fixed pin 1 and boss 6,
The both sides up and down of 1 same end face of the fixed plate are respectively equipped with boss 6, and fixed plate 1 is equipped with fixed pin 1, and fixed pin 1 is set
In in the mounting hole of part 3,3 both sides of part are respectively equipped with positioning framework 2, and positioning framework 2 is fixedly connected in fixed plate 1, pressure
Block 4 is slidably connected with positioning framework 2, and 4 one end of briquetting fits with boss 6, and 4 other end of briquetting is fixedly connected with part 3.It is described
4 top of briquetting is threaded with threaded rod 7, and positioning framework 2 is equipped with sliding slot 8, and the shaft of threaded rod 7 passes through sliding slot 8.It is described fixed
Position 2 both ends of frame are fixedly connected on by bolt 9 in fixed plate 1 respectively.4 bottom end of the briquetting is equipped with fixed pin 2 10, fixed
Pin 2 10 is placed in the jack on part 3.
In conjunction with shown in attached drawing 1, attached drawing 2 and attached drawing 3, set on a positioning framework 2 there are three briquetting 4, the height of boss 6 with
3 height of part being fixed in fixed plate 1 is consistent, and the head of threaded rod 7 can not pass through sliding slot 8.Part 3 is inserted into first
On fixed pin 1 in fixed plate 1.Then briquetting 4 is slided along the sliding slot 8 on positioning framework 2, so that three
Briquetting 4 is worked good the width of part 3, and rotating threaded rod 7, will turn threaded rod 7 and be screwed into the threaded hole of briquetting 4 at this time, until
The head of briquetting 4 and threaded rod 7 is tightly attached to the upper and lower ends of positioning framework 2 respectively, realizes that briquetting 4 is fixed with positioning framework 2 and connects
It connects.One end of briquetting 4 is pressed on boss 6 at this time, and the fixed pin 2 10 on the other end is inserted into the jack of part 3, and with zero
Part 3 fits.Briquetting 4 can be kept to keep balance in compressing component 3 in this way.Positioning framework 2 is fixed finally by bolt 9
In fixed plate 1, achieve a fixed connection.The part 3 being fixed in fixed plate 1 can be finally processed.
